Can you point me to somewhere that shows about the Garmin registry tweaks to improve its usability and user interface? All I can find is instructions on how to reduce lag and how to move to a larger storage card. Ive been googling for an hour. Id love to add some commenly needed buttons to some menus.
My garmin also saves to contacts fine but only when in options for a poi. If I click on the map and save that spot it will auto name it (location 5) and show in on the map. I then have to click on location 5 to see the location options. And clicking on location 5 is hard to do.
Oh I just figured it out but it still requires way to many steps. If I tap on a place on the map then instead of hitting save location tap on the icon in the top right (circle with an i inside) then click on the lable for the spot on the map, then click on options, then save to contacts. But it still forces me to use auto naming and that requires many many more steps to re name. And it wont let me save it to an existing contact. Instead click on tools/manage my data/contacts.

Re: TP2 + Garmin XT

I'll jump on the bump bandwagon!
Garmin XT ROCKS!

Unlike Goog maps, bing.. you DON"T need the internet, so if you use it for hunting or fishing in Bummm F Egypt like I do... the others don't work, as there are no towers to pull their maps down. I must have basemaps & detail maps (logging roads, etc) ON my SD card, 8 miles back on the great divide you won't get squat for a tower...

I turn all radios off (airplane mode), set backlight to lowest & bring an extra battery, lasts for many days.

Re. tower questions above.. 3 ways to get GPS signal
1. tower triangulation (location btwn 1/5 mile & 1/2) (poor) (No GPS chip in phone)
2. GPS chip in phone
3. Using both (TP2) (faster)

Faster yet:
And you can assist satellite lock in with progs "QuickGPS" which downloads all sat locations from internet every week & uses phone as a computer to assist fast GPS lock in based off anticipated/estimated satellite locations (from downloaded satellite tracking data). AND, using AGPS check box in settings/other
